Opis
Tisha Morris delves into the emotional ties people have with their possessions in this insightful exploration of how clutter can hinder personal growth. She unpacks the psychological barriers that prevent individuals from decluttering their lives and addresses the deeper issues associated with attachment to objects. Through relatable anecdotes and practical advice, Morris offers strategies for readers to confront their belongings and understand the underlying reasons for their struggles with letting go.
This journey of self-discovery encourages individuals to reevaluate their relationship with their things, prompting transformations in both their physical space and mental state. Morris empowers readers to embrace a lighter, more intentional lifestyle, revealing how liberating it can be to release the weight of excessive possessions. By addressing the roots of clutter, she guides them toward a path of clarity and freedom, making emotional and physical renewal achievable.
